- the invention relates to the pocket system for medical use.
- pocket systems for medical use of the type comprising on a pocket at least one sterile injection site, allowing the injection of a certain product in the pocket using a needle and syringe injection.
- Such a sterile injection site is in fact provided to be able to be crossed by an injection needle and close itself once the needle is removed.
- Document DE-U-295 15 682 describes such a system in which a cover snap-in is intended to be placed on the injection site so that shut it off once an injection is made.
- the invention therefore aims to remedy these drawbacks by proposing a system pocket comprising a security means associated with it in a set unitary, said safety means cannot be dissociated from the injection site after mounting to irreversibly prevent another injection.
- the invention proposes a pocket system for medical use, of the type comprising on a pocket at least one site sterile injection, further comprising at least one safety means, the safety means and the injection site being arranged so that the means can be mounted - in particular by simply pressing it in - on the injection site by preventing injection by the site, the safety means and the pocket can not be separated by manual action, the means of safety being integrated into the pocket system to be, at least before mounting at the injection site, associated with it in a unitary assembly.
- the injection site can be protected by a tearable envelope intended to be broken prior to injection of the product.
- the security means is associated by means of frangible means, broken up with a view to mounting the security means on site sterile injection, and / or by non-frangible means, both before and view of the mounting of the safety device on the sterile injection site.
- the security means is associated by means either essentially rigid or flexible, in particular elastic.
- Flexible means of association, particularly elastic are suitable, in particular by their length and their flexibility, to allow the safety device to be associated with the injection site sterile.
- the means of association of the security means are in one embodiment associated on the one hand with the pocket proper, or with a tab or a border depending on the bag or at the sterile injection site; on the other hand to the face external of the safety means, on the skirt or the transverse end face, especially in an essentially rigid manner.
- the means of association of the security means with the pocket system are by example a material bridge, a frangible line, a leg, a cord or analogous, a band.
- the safety means can be in two extreme positions, one before mounting on the sterile injection site, in particular in a fixed position and against or in the vicinity of the pocket and the other on the site itself.
- the invention relates to an implementation method of a pocket system of the invention, in which one starts from a system with pocket in which the security means, although associated with the system, is removed the sterile injection site and thus leaves its free access for injection; when necessary a certain product is injected into the pocket through the site injection; once the injection has been carried out, the safety means are mounted on the injection site thereby irreversibly preventing any further injection through the site in question.

- a pocket system for medical use 1 will now be described with reference in a normal position of use in which the contents of bag 2 go be distributed, for example to a patient.
- the pocket 2 is suspended by its upper extremity. This situation allows you to define the qualifiers “upper”, “lower” and “lateral”.
- the pocket system 1 first comprises a closed envelope 3, then a injection site 4 and finally a distribution site 5, the two sites 4 and 5 being mounted on said envelope 3.
- the envelope 3 is intended to receive a content C such as a solute, a powder, blood, a serum or a blood component.
- a content C such as a solute, a powder, blood, a serum or a blood component.
- the injection site 4 allows the injection of a certain product P, for example a drug, or a solvent in pocket 2 using a needle and a injection syringe.
- a certain product P for example a drug, or a solvent in pocket 2 using a needle and a injection syringe.
- the distribution site 5 is designed to deliver the C + P content from the bag 2, for example to a patient through an infusion device conventional.
- the bag system 1 can be packaged under a film flexible and waterproof plastic to ensure its sterility. The film is then broken before using the bag system 1.
- the pocket system 1 which has just been described constitutes an elementary assembly which can be incorporated into a more complex system which includes example of other bags, tubing, clamps or filters, which elements will not be described further.
- the pocket system 1 comprises an envelope 3 in the form of a flattened tube in flexible plastic material whose transverse end portions 6, 7 have been transversely welded.
- the envelope 3 has two orifices 8, 9 located on the same transverse side of the envelope, namely lower 7.
- the upper side 6 includes an eyelet 10 which allows the attachment of the bag system 1, for example on an infusion stand.
- the pocket system 1 according to the invention may comprise more than two holes arranged differently on the casing 3.
- the two orifices 8, 9 are of generally cylindrical shape and are each provided a portion of tube 11, 12 ensuring fluid communication with outside of envelope 3.
- the site is tightly mounted Injection 4.
- the injection site 4 is formed by an end piece hollow 13 of cylindrical shape made of rigid plastic material (see figure 1).
- the injection site can be protected by an envelope tearable intended to be broken prior to the injection of the product P. This arrangement allowing, when the tearable envelope is intact, to show that no product P was injected into bag 2.
- the nozzle 13 of the injection site 4 has two parts 14, 15, one intended for be introduced in a leaktight manner into the tube portion 11 projecting from the envelope 3 while the other, of slightly larger diameter, remains at outside in the extension of said portion of tube 11.
- the diameter of the second part 15 being provided to form a circular flat 16 of low thickness at the junction between the end piece 13 and the protruding tube portion 11 of the envelope 3.
- a pad 17 of elastomer, rubber or the like is arranged inside the second part 15 of the end piece 13 to form the site 4. This is provided so that it can be crossed by a needle and close itself once the needle is removed.
- a tubing system 18 is tightly mounted to deliver the contents of pocket 2, for example to a patient via a conventional infusion (not shown).
- the pocket system 1 also includes, in an integrated manner, a security means 19 intended, once the product P has been introduced into the bag 2, to obstruct the injection site 4 so as to prevent, so irreversible, a second injection.
- the security means 19 is integrated into the pocket system 1 so that before mounting it is associated with it in a unitary whole.
- system is meant unitary the fact that the pocket system 1 and the security means 19 are stored, sold, handled and used together.
- the security means 19 is formed by a plug 21 made of rigid plastic material intended to obstruct the site 4 to prevent a second injection.
- the plug 21 can be brightly colored in order to also visualize the realization of a injection.
- the means of association of the security means 19 with the pocket system 1 can be the subject of several variants.
- frangible means 22 consisting for example of a thinned material bridge or a point of glue formed between the safety means 19 and the pocket system 1.
- frangible means 22 are broken during use, the safety means 19 then dissociated from the envelope 3 can be associated with the injection site 4.
- the means 23 provide a connection security means 19 to the envelope 3.
- the safety means 19 is associated with the pocket system 1 by a flexible cord 23 and by frangible means 22.
- This variant ensures a connection security means 19 to the envelope 3 while benefiting from the advantages of frangible means 22.
- the means of association of the security means 19 with the pocket system 1 are associated on the one hand with the external face of the security means 19 and on the other hand, either to the envelope 3 of the bag 2 (see Figure 1) near the injection site 4 but wide enough to allow free access either directly to the site injection 4 (see Figure 3).
- the plug 21 and the safety means 19 are produced, for example by molding, in a single piece formed of the same material.
- the safety means are formed by a thinned material bridge having sufficient flexibility and length to allow mounting the plug 21 on the injection site 4.
- the combination of plug 21 to the pocket system can be produced by arranging and welding a part of the material bridge around the tube portion 11 so as to form a ring whose diameter is less than that of part 15.
- the flat 16 prevents the sliding of the ring so that the security means 19 and the pocket system 1 forms a unitary assembly.
- association means comprise frangible means 22, these are broken manually to allow the mounting of the safety means 19 at the injection site 4.
- the safety means 19 is then mounted by forced insertion on the part lower 15 of the nozzle 13, the safety means 19 coming to engage on the flat 16 to lock it irreversibly (see Figure 2). Inviolability of the injection site 4 is then ensured by irreversible locking of the security 19.
- the arrangement is provided so that the pocket system 1 and safety means 19 cannot be separated by manual action once said safety means 19 has been mounted on the injection site 4.
- the security means 19 has a small size (around 1 cm in diameter) and a surface smooth outer so it has little grip to be removed manually.
- the skirt of the plug 21 is slightly tightened at the level of the opening part so that this part comes to lock on the flat part 16.
- the plug 21 is forced into the injection site 4 up to the flat 16 and the opening part of the plug 21 is locked on said flat 16 so as to prevent any removal of the plug 21 from on the site injection 4.
